Most of Oklahoma was part of the Louisiana Purchase under Thomas Jefferson. The panhandle section was part of Texas, which was not purchased, but became independent and voluntarily joined the union.
Oklahoma was admitted into the Union on November 16, 1907 becoming the 46th state to join the Union. Theodore Roosevelt was President of the United States when Oklahoma was admitted into the union.
